How to Copy a Telegram Video Link

A short guide for getting the right Telegram link before you try to download anything.

Published 2026-04-28

Quick Answer

Open the exact Telegram video message, use the share or copy-link option, and make sure the URL points to one supported public video.

1. Open the exact Telegram video first

  1. Open the Telegram video you actually want to save.
  2. Avoid copying the profile page or search feed URL.
  3. Stay on the single video page before using Share.

2. Use Share to copy the public link

Tap or click Share, then use the copy-link option. That usually gives you the public URL Snapvie needs instead of a temporary in-app path.

3. Check that the link still points to the video

If the copied URL opens the video when you paste it into a browser tab, you have the right kind of link. If it drops you onto a profile or a blank page, copy it again from the video screen.

If the copied link still fails later

Refresh the Telegram page, copy the public link again, and make sure the video is still public. Old or altered links are one of the most common reasons a Telegram download fails.
